What type of star is Agena?

Beta Centauri (also known as Hadar or Agena) is a blue white giant star in the constellation Centaurus.It has a spectral class of B1

What is the magnitude of Hadar?

Beta Centauri (Hadar or Agena) is the second brightest star in the constellation Centaurus.It has an apparent magnitude of 0.6 -> 0.8 (It's a variable star) or an absolute magnitude of -4.57

What is the color of Hadar?

Beta Centauri (Hadar or Agena) is the second brightest star in the constellation Centaurus and the tenth brightest star in the night sky.It has a spectral class of B1 and it is a blue-white giant star.

When was the first space station flight?

It depends how you define space station, the Unmanned Atlas-Agena docking platform was used in the Gemini shots as a sort of practice device for rendezvous and docking This was in the mid-late sixties- once coupled to the Agena stage- the astros could light off the Agena engine and in theory boost their orbit- there were a number of seriious problems with the coupling procedure, and it is a good thing the Agena was unmanned- but a useful training device, like AA drones- which paved the way for the much later space outposts such as the Mir and International Space Station.
